Potential Hazards and Risks

Encountering Bees and Wasps can lead to stings, allergic reactions, or even nest disturbances. It’s essential to be aware of their presence, especially in outdoor work environments, and take necessary precautions to avoid incidents.

Best Practices for Safety

When working in areas where Bees and Wasps are present, remember to stay calm and move away slowly if you encounter them. Avoid swatting or making sudden movements that could agitate them. Additionally, wearing protective clothing and keeping food covered can help minimize the risk of stings.

Practical Tips for Working Safely

Here are some actionable tips to keep in mind when working around Bees and Wasps:

  • Inspect work areas for signs of nests or hives before starting any tasks.
  • Keep food and drinks in sealed containers to avoid attracting Bees and Wasps.
  • Stay alert and listen for buzzing sounds that may indicate their presence nearby.
  • If stung, seek medical attention immediately, especially if you experience severe reactions.
